Sirenza Microdevices' SBW-5089 is a high performance
InGaP/GaAs Heterojunction Bipolar Transistor MMIC
Amplifier. A Darlington configuration designed with InGaP
process technology provides broadband performance up to
8 GHz with excellent thermal performance. The heterojunction
increases breakdown voltage and minimizes leakage current
between junctions. Cancellation of emitter junction nonlinearities results in higher suppression of intermodulation products. Only a single positive supply voltage, DC-blocking capacitors, a bias resistor, and an optional RF choke are required for operation.
Product Features
- Wideband Flat Gain to 3GHz: +-1.4dB
- P1dB @ 6 GHz = 13.4dBm
- Input/Output VSWR <2.3 thru 8GHz
- Operates from Single Supply
- Robust 1000V ESD, Class 1C
- Patented Thermally Distributed Design
Product Applications
- Broadband Instrumentation
- Cellular, PCS, GSM, UMTS PA Drivers
- Sat Com Terminals
- Fiber Optic Driver
